Resumo: Introduction: The aim of this study was to compare the efficacy and efficiency of clear aligners and 2x4 fixed appliances for solving maxillary incisor position irregularities in the mixed dentition. Methods: The sample was composed by 27 patients from 7 to 11 years of age that were randomly allocated into two treatment groups: Group CA 14 patients treated with invisible aligners; and Group FA 13 patients treated partial fixed appliances in a 2x4 mechanics. Digital models were acquired before treatment (T1) and after the appliance removal (T2). Primary outcomes were: Little irregularity index and treatment time. Secondary outcomes were arch width, perimeter and length, arch size and shape, incisors levelling, plaque and ICDAS index. Intergroup comparisons were evaluated using Student t-test and Wilcoxon test with Holm-Bonferroni correction (p < 0.05). Results: The final sample comprised 14 patients (6 female, 8 male) with a mean age of 9.3 years (SD=1.0) in Group CA and 13 patients (9 female, 4 male) with a mean age of 9.6 years (SD=0.8) in Group FA. No intergroup differences were observed for changes in the incisor irregularity index. Treatment time was similar in both groups. Arch width, length, size and shape changes presented similar changes during treatment. Plaque and ICDAS index showed no differences between groups. Conclusion: Clear aligners and 2x4 mechanics presented similar efficacy and efficiency for maxillary incisor positional corrections in the mixed dentition.
